    Hello. I used the Merge Clip function to sync video and two recordings (three tracks) of audio. In the merge clip dialogue box, I selected Sync Point: Audio (Track Channel 1). For most of my clips, this function worked fine. But for one clip, two of the three audio tracks are one frame out of sync. How do I get them back in sync and remaining in a merged clip?

    I tried opening the clip as a merged clip sequence (holding down shift and double clicking the merged clip), and that opened the clip as a sequence I was able to edit (slipping the audio by one frame to get it back in sync), but the modified sequence doesn’t fix the problem in the “master” merged clip. So it doesn’t help me use the original merged clip in a new timeline. So is there a way to save that sequence as a merged clip?

    I’d prefer not to export that new sequence as a new master clip.

    I’m working on Premiere Pro 13.1.5 on a Mac OS 10.13.6.
